Slip Cellular lining


This is the oldest method amongst all the trenchless repair service options. With this recovery method, the plumber inserts a smaller sized pipe right into the old one. From there, the space in between both pipelines is full of cement causing a new pipeline within. Both the grout as well as brand-new pipe enhance the harmed one. However, this is still one of the most intrusive as the plumbing will certainly still need to dig sufficient to position the brand-new pipeline and cement.

Spray Cellular lining


Others call this method brush finishing due to the fact that a thin layer of versatile polymer is splashed or covered right into the old pipe. A modern maker is put right into your sewer line using little holes. Once, the sprayed material sets on the surface of the old pipe, it will certainly solidify and also secure off fractures and also pinholes. It additionally strengthens the old pipe's outer walls.

Cured-in-Place


The CIPP approach does specifically as it states as it cures a brand-new pipeline in place. Others call this architectural pipelining as an epoxy material liner is inserted after that inflated in the broken drain line using modern tools. As an outcome, you have actually obtained a new pipe within the old pipeline.

    The Age of Your Sewer System


    An aging and deteriorating sewer system is the primary culprit behind most sewage backups. Unfortunately, if you have an old sewer system, backup and backup prevention devices won’t do much good. Contact us to learn more about what you can do if you have an aging sewer system.


    Storm-Sewer Combined Pipelines


    A storm drain connected to a sewer line is what we mean by storm-sewer combined pipelines. Due to the storm drain debris, combined pipelines increase the risk of clogs and sewage backups. So, if your property has a storm-sewer combined pipeline, then you’re at a higher risk of a problem.     Tree Roots


    Tree roots actively seek underground water sources. So, since water flows through your sewer line, tree roots naturally grow towards, and sometimes into, them. When tree roots grow inside your sewer line, they increase your risk of a backup event.
